How to prepare for a job interview at United Cerebral Palsy of Georgia

Know Your Mechanical Systems

Make sure you brush up on the specific mechanical systems relevant to the role. Be prepared to discuss your experience with maintenance operations and any hands-on leadership you've provided in previous positions.

Showcase Your Leadership Skills

As a Mechanical Lead Engineer, you'll need to demonstrate your ability to lead a team effectively. Think of examples where you've successfully managed a team or project, and be ready to share how you motivated others and resolved conflicts.

Understand the Company Culture

Research the company and its values before the interview. Understanding their culture will help you tailor your responses and show that you're a good fit for their team. Mention how your personal values align with theirs during the conversation.

Prepare Questions to Ask

Interviews are a two-way street, so prepare insightful questions to ask your interviewers. Inquire about the challenges they face in mechanical maintenance or how they measure success in this role. This shows your genuine interest and helps you assess if it's the right fit for you.
